Laser-Produced Plasma as an Effective Source of Multicharged Ions

Description
Properties of expanding laser plasma as a source of highly charged, energetic ions are discussed. A possibility to use sub-nanosecond near-infrared systems as driving lasers of the ion source is highlighted. Experimental data characterising the laser driven ion source performance are presented. A physical interpretation of experimental findings is outlined. (author)
